Why Haven’t Children Slept Well for More Than 100 Years?

It may not be news to you that today’s kids are deprived of sleep, but before you blame smartphones or computer games, consider this: children haven’t been getting enough shut-eye for more than a century.

Your Walking Speed and Grip Strength May Predict Stroke, Dementia Risks

A new study finds that how fast you can walk and the strength of your hand grip may predict the odds of having a stroke or memory problems later in life.

Fetal Exposure to Radiation Increases Risk of Testicular Cancer

Male fetuses of mothers exposed to radiation during early pregnancy may have a higher chance of developing testicular cancer, according to a new study from the University of Texas MD Anderson Cancer Center.

Air Pollution Linked to an Increased Risk of Strokes, Heart Attacks

In a study published Monday in the Archives of Internal Medicine, analysis of over a decade of data suggests that even a brief rise in traffic-related air pollution could increase someone’s short-term risk of stroke.
